Abstract
The utility model discloses an LCD testing tool which is characterized by including a camera obscura, a base and a carrying platform which are successively arranged in the camera obscura from bottom to top, a pick-up head fixed at the top of the camera obscura, a signal transmission module, and an automatic detection system. The base and the carrying platform are fixedly connected, the signal transmission module is electrically connected with an LCD to be detected, and the automatic detection system is electrically connected with the pick-up head to receive image signals transmitted by the pick-up head. The LCD testing tool is simple in structure and convenient in operation; the LCD testing tool can quickly determine the good and bad of products by picking up all of the processes displayed by the LCD via the pick-up head, the detection result is accurate, stable and reliable, and reduces the fraction defective of the products; in addition, the LCD testing tool uses the automatic detection system to perform the detection, and the detection is fast in speed, thereby greatly improving the work efficiency.

Background technology
Development along with flat panel display, LCD with its low-voltage, little power consumption, panelized, miniature portable, be easy to the advantages such as circuit is integrated and constantly satisfy the day by day diversified functional requirement of people and individual demand, be widely used in various electronic products, comprise all products of LCD display as computer, peripheral vehicle electronic equipment, mobile phone, net book, MP4, MP5 etc.Usually, LCD screen all can be lighted it before encapsulation procedure and wait test, produced test signal by measurement jig, and then signal is sent in the LCD screen, made LCD shield to begin luminous.Existing LCD measurement jig, be mainly whether the content that adopts the method for artificial visual to judge that the LCD screen display shows by experienced personnel correct, brightness whether enough and mounting finished product whether tilt, only judge the quality of product with experience, not only risk, and inefficiency, and the result that detects lacks reliability and stability.

Embodiment
Below in conjunction with the drawings and specific embodiments, the utility model is done concrete introduction.
Referring to figs. 1 through Fig. 3, the utility model LCD measurement jig comprises: camera bellows 1, the pedestal 2, the microscope carrier 3 that set gradually from bottom to up in camera bellows 1 inside are fixed in the camera 4 at camera bellows 1 top and signal transmission module (not shown).Wherein, camera bellows 1 is used for lucifuge, and camera 4 pictures taken, the testing product qualified suitable environment that provides whether is provided; Microscope carrier 3 is used for carrying LCD6 to be detected; Pedestal 2 is arranged at the bottommost of camera bellows 1, is used for carrying microscope carrier 3, pedestal 2 with microscope carrier 3 for being fixedly connected with, being fixedly connected with by bolt 5 realizations for example; Signal transmission module is used for contacting with LCD6 to be detected by probe and provides test signal for LCD6 to be detected; Camera 4 is used for taking all processes that LCD6 to be detected shows, so the position of camera 4 is over against LCD6 to be detected.
In order conveniently to pick and place LCD6 to be detected, be provided with slide rail 7 below pedestal 2, pedestal 2 slides on slide rail 7, thereby drives microscope carrier 3, LCD6 to be detected slip.
As a kind of preferred scheme, camera bellows 1 is provided with sliding door 8, and sliding door 8 is fixedly connected with pedestal 2.By pushing away, draw sliding door 8, can pick and place easily LCD6 to be detected.
As a kind of preferred scheme, be provided with collision bead 9 on sliding door 8.Collision bead 9 can guarantee that sliding door 8 is closed tight, thereby guarantees the photophobism of camera bellows 1 inside.
In order to guarantee that LCD6 to be detected has the optimum position in the visual field of camera 4, be also simultaneously in order to improve shooting quality, camera 4 is adjustable with respect to the position of LCD6 to be detected.As a kind of preferred scheme, it can be realized by camera adjustable plate 10.Concrete, camera adjustable plate 10 is the L-type plate, is formed with mounting hole 11 on it, then is fixedly connected with camera bellows 1, camera 4 respectively by bolt, thereby realizes that camera 4 is with respect to the fine adjustment of the position of LCD6 to be detected.
For make camera bellows 1 inner structure succinct, avoid signal transmission module affect the shooting effect of camera 4, as a kind of preferred scheme, the microscope carrier 3 in the utility model is formed with cavity, signal transmits module and is arranged in the cavity of microscope carrier 3.
As a kind of preferred scheme, LCD measurement jig of the present utility model also includes automatic checkout system (scheming not shown).This automatic checkout system is electrically connected to camera 4, receive the picture signal that it transmits, and according to the parameter of prior setting etc. judge whether the content that LCD shows correct, brightness whether enough and mounting finished product whether tilt, detection speed is fast, has greatly improved work efficiency.
